Someone from outside is trying to login our Fortigate VPN
How to prevent if someone trying to login Fortigate VPN, getting notification : Message meets Alert condition
The following critical firewall event was detected: SSL VPN login fail.
Every time remote IP is different. Our VPN has self signed certificate with strong credential.
Because the person who is trying to get inside, from log showing error sslvpn_login_cert_checked_error.
Any suggestion and advice highly appreciated.

Hello. Have you looked at:
VPN>SSL-VPN Settings and then "Limit access to specific hosts"? You can geo-block from here too.
